How Our Subfloor Water Extraction Service Actually Works
When you call us, our team will rush to your location within 60 minutes, equipped with the necessary gear to assess and extract the water from your subfloor. The sooner we start, the better, every hour counts in preventing further damage. Our process involves several key steps, each designed to ensure your home is restored to its original condition.
Step 1: Inspection and Assessment
Our technician will arrive at your home, equipped with moisture-detecting equipment to identify the extent of the damage. This step is crucial in determining the best course of action for your subfloor water extraction.
Step 2: Water Extraction
We’ll use a combination of pumps and vacuums to extract the water from your subfloor, removing as much moisture as possible. This step can take anywhere from a few hours to several days, depending on the size of the affected area.
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ification
Once the water is extracted, we’ll use industrial-grade dehumidifiers to dry out the area, ensuring that no moisture remains to cause further damage. This step is critical in preventing mold growth and structural issues.
Step 4: Sanitizing and Disinfecting
To prevent bacterial growth and the spread of mold, we’ll apply a sanitizing solution to all affected areas. This step is essential in ensuring your home is safe and healthy to live in.
Step 5: Follow-up Inspection
After the extraction, drying, and sanitizing process, our technician will return to your home to conduct a final inspection. This ensures that all moisture has been removed and your home is safe and secure.

Warning Signs You Need Subfloor Water Extraction
Ignoring the warning signs of subfloor water damage can lead to costly repairs and health risks. Here are some common signs to look out for:
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
Strong, persistent odors can show the presence of mold or mildew in your subfloor. If you notice these smells, it’s time to call in a professional to extract the water and prevent further damage.
Warped or Buckled Flooring
Visible signs of warping or buckling in your flooring can be a sign of water damage beneath. This can lead to structural issues and safety hazards, so it’s essential to address the problem quickly.
Visible Water Stains or Spots
If you notice water stains or spots on your ceiling or walls, it’s likely that water has penetrated your subfloor. This can lead to further damage and costly repairs if left unchecked.
Unusual Sounds or Creaks
Unusual sounds or creaks in your floors or walls can show the presence of water damage or structural issues. Don’t ignore these signs, call us today to schedule a consultation.
Peeling Paint or Wallpaper
Peeling paint or wallpaper can be a sign of water damage or high humidity levels in your home. If you notice these signs, it’s time to address the issue before it becomes a bigger problem.

Subfloor Water Extraction Cost In Wyckoff, NJ
The cost of subfloor water extraction in Wyckoff, NJ can vary depending on the severity and size of the affected area. Here are some estimated price ranges for common sub-services:
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Initial Inspection and Assessment | $100 – $500 | Size of affected area, complexity of damage |
| Water Extraction (small area) | $500 – $2,000 | Size of affected area, type of equipment required |
| Water Extraction (large area) | $2,000 – $5,000 | Size of affected area, type of equipment required, complexity of damage |
| Drying and Dehumidification | $1,000 – $3,000 | Size of affected area, type of equipment required, duration of drying process |
| Sanitizing and Disinfecting | $500 – $2,000 | Size of affected area, type of equipment required, complexity of damage |
